White Hall, Il vs Morelia, Mich. Climate & Distance Between

Mexico flag
  • The distance between White Hall, Il, Usa and Morelia, Mich., Mexico is approximately 2,400 km or 1,491 mi.
  • To reach White Hall, Il in this distance one would set out from Morelia, Mich. bearing 24.2°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ach White Hall, Il bearing 29.8° or NNE .
  • White Hall, Il has a hot summer continental climate with no dry season (Dfa) whereas Morelia, Mich. has a subtropical highland climate with dry winters (Cwb).
  • White Hall, Il is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Morelia, Mich. is in or near the subtropical dry for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 6.6 °C (11.9°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 22 °C (39.6°F) more in White Hall, Il.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 154.1 mm (6.1 in) more which is equivalent to 154.1 l/m² (3.78 US gal/ft²) or 1,541,000 l/ha (164,743 US gal/ac) more. About 1 1/5 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 18.3° lower in White Hall, Il than in Morelia, Mich..
